Abstract
This paper reviews the work done by the senior author and his colleagues over the last ten years on development and application of a range of tools to support irrigation management. The management process is described as a layered structure connectingthe social context with on-farm operations through subsequent domains of decision. The relevance of decision-support computational tools is described with examples from past applications.
